Sheikh Gumi urges Hamas to release Isreali civilian hostages
Sheikh Ahmad Gumi, a prominent Kaduna-based Islamic cleric, has urged Palestinian Islamist group Hamas to immediately release all Israeli civilian hostages without conditions.
Posting on his verified Facebook page on Saturday, Gumi described the initial abductions as a strategic error and said Hamas should rethink its approach to reclaiming land.
The cleric’s comments came as Hamas agreed to free Israeli hostages under a ceasefire plan facilitated by United States President Donald Trump, who also called on Israel to halt bombing in Gaza.

Gumi wrote, “Ok, now, Hamas should release all civilian hostages without any conditions. It’s a miscalculation to abduct them in the first place.
“Hamas should just re-plan to take back their indigenous land through the clean use of force, which is their right to use and defend. Then Allah will give them a clear victory. And it’s coming,” he wrote.
